WOW! Keep up the good work! Could you tell me about how many grams of Protein you get everyday on average? And Water? I struggle to get in 50 grams.

Thank you! I am averaging about 40-60 grams of Protein a day,I seriously need to work on upping it but I try as hard as I can. You need between 60-80 grams,some docs even say 100! I am averaging anywhere between 20 ounces(on a bad or very busy day) and 60 ounces of liquids a day. You need at least 64 ounces so I need to up that too. It requires constant sipping. It is do-able,I just think our sleeves take a while to adjust and for all of the swelling to go down completely. I think this next month I will be able to reach my liquid and protein goals more easily. =) I do feel like I would have maybe lost more in my first month if I would have consumed more liquids and protein,but 20 lbs is still awesome so I'll def take that! Oh,one good trick to getting some of your liquids AND Proteins in at the same time is to get a 20 oz bottle full of Water, add a thing of lemonade crystal light to it,then add a whole packet (or scoop if you bought a whole container) of strawberry Protein powder. Makes the most refreshing strawberry lemonade drink and if you finish the whole thing that's 20 ozs of water(1/3 of your Fluid intake for the day) and 20 grams of protein!
